MTB Sulzbach - Spessart Nature Park

02:30

27.1km

530m

Mountain biking

Moderate mountain bike ride. Good fitness required. Advanced riding skills necessary. The starting point of the route is right next to a parking lot.

Last updated: January 13, 2025

Tips

Includes a very steep uphill segment

You may need to push your bike.

After 8.28 km for 413 m

The Sulzbacher Mtb has yellow signs with a black arrow. It is easy to ride and has a good balance between trails, forest paths and technical demands. Unfortunately, there were log haulers on the paths in two places. In photos 20/21 and 45. Great weather, great round!

Just a short ride today – so it's a good time to take a closer look at the Sulzbach MTB Club's circuit. The Schweinheim Forest is a nature trail El Dorado for me💚, so I was curious to see what awaited us just around the corner...and what might reveal something new to me. There were plenty of trails, but also quite a few gravel roads, which was a shame, because there's a great narrow path lurking around almost every bend. I found the few trail uphills a bit unfortunate, as they were steep, especially at the start, and sometimes quite impassable. Very nice and typical of this area are the many rooty and sandy nature trails, which are great even after heavy rain or in winter without sinking into the mud. The finisher's drinks were held at the very nice Ellis Gartenwirtschaft.

Today in glorious weather in the Spessart - a tour by Chris through some well-known and much new territory. First of all: The Obernauer Forest, where I've ridden 50% of the trails - always cool and not exhausting. Unfortunately, the Sulzabcher MTB Club circuit was 70% wide forest highways with a few short trail sections (combined more by sight) and three steep climbs, otherwise rather easy and fast to drive. As I said - a few detours away from the official route then increased the proportion of trails. The highlight was the suspension bridge over the "gorge" - which is not on the route. So today a lot of km, a few meters in altitude and a moderate proportion of trails. This has to get better.
